Hi. I worked with the op last night and resolved the problem. The dgconnectidentifier was pointing to a dynamic service. We changed the tnsnames entry for the dgconnectidentifier to point to the static service and that resolved the issue.

> Isn't LOCAL_LISTENER used only for dynamic service registration? If the services are statically registered with the listeners, there shouldn't be any need to set the LOCAL_LISTENER parameter.

>> You seem to have a somewhat complex setup (unless details have been edited to protect security). You'll want to read, and get your head around Oracle Data Guard Broker and Static Service Registration (Doc ID 1387859.1) . It looks to me as though you're in the maintain configuration manually section of that doc.  
>> 
>> You have 
>> 
>> HOST: PRIME 
>> SID: PRIME 
>> LISTENER : LISTENER_PRIME port 1540 
>> 
>> HOST: STANDBY
>> SID: STANDBY
>> LISTENER: LISTENER_STANDBY port 1545 
>> 
>> You've I think edited the static connect identifiers to correctly try to connect to <db_unique_name>_DGMGRL on the 2 ports above. I suspect that you haven't updated LOCAL_LISTENER to point at the non-standard listener. To get your current configuration to work you'll need I think to update local_listener appropriately and then recreate the dg broker config. Is there a reason that you aren't using 1521, and/or a different port on standby from primary ?
